So glad we called Budget when our 30-year-old furnace stopped working. This was on a Tuesday. They were at our home in a couple hours to evaluate the problem. Since the required part was expensive and considering the age of our furnace, we decided to buy a new furnace, which they installed on Thursday. All of the Budget people and technicians were great, the installation went smoothly, and we're very happy with Budget and our new furnace.
Description of Work: Possible repair of old furnace, installation of new furnace

I wanted to have my air conditioning unit checked before my home warranty expired in a couple of weeks. I received a text message when the technician, Sam, was on his way. Sam was extremely friendly and courteous. While he only did minor maintenance, he explained everything throughout the process, offered some advice, and answered all of my questions. I would consider using them again. Price was fair; not too high or too low.
Description of Work: General service call for air conditioning unit that was taking a very long time to cool down. Recharged system slightly.

Our heat went out on Friday night of the coldest week of the year. We were freezing and desperate. We saw the good reviews on yelp and google and decided to call on Saturday morning. By 2, Sam was here and went straight to work. He diagnosed the issues quickly, communicated what was going on and what my options are, requested a discount for me from the office since I had to pay the emergency service call fee, and got everything in shape in under an hour. I was very suprised when I came on here to see that the business has a "B." They definitely deserve an "A" on every metric. I had to do my part to let you all know that they deserve your business. I was as pleased with his friendly personality as I was his technical expertise. I will definitely call Budget for all my HVAC needs going forward. And I will ask for Sam.
Description of Work: Emergency service, diagnosed issues, rewired the thermastat, replaced a pressure switch and cleaned a vent.

The provider was one we didn't select: They were sent by our home warranty provider. I was a tad cautious after reading some other negative reviews on this site, but Sam (the man who came) was courteous and quick, explained what he did to execute the quick fix (on a HOT day, I must say!), and even killed a spider for me. (Sorry, spider.) I would hire this company again, and I am a pretty picky, inquisitive woman, so that is saying something.
Description of Work: We had a furnace that was turning on, but an AC unit outside that wouldn't turn on with it, meaning we had no central air. Budget HVAC replaced our contactor.

This company was contracted through our HSA home warranty they were initially hard to get an appointment with but once we had an appointment the tech showed up on time and was efficient. We were told we had a leak and the refrigerant just needed to be recharged. He did the repair on 4/22/2013. This was the last time our unit was serviced. Fast forward to last week, 5/12/15, when we were having issues again. I tried contact this company again and they never returned my call so I called another company. The other company came out and said we had a leak again and needed to be recharged. He then discovered that the previous leak had been fixed improperly with a sealant instead of replacing a valve. He couldn't even get coolant into the system and said we needed to replace the whole thing. I tried again to contact Budget with no response so I have filed a complaint through the BBB and there has been no response after a week. I also got a second opinion with the same conclusion. I just want to share my story so that people can be informed about doing business with this company.
Description of Work: Fixed a leak and recharged coolant in AC system.
